three main factors that affect stroke volume and how each impacts cardiac output if that factor is increased?

Answers

The three main factors that affect stroke volume are contractility, preload and afterload.

Increase in contractility and preload increases cardiac output whereas increase in afterload decreases cardiac output.

What is stroke volume?

Stroke volume refers to the volume of blood that is pumped by the heart through each stroke.

The three factors that affect stroke volume and how it impacts cardiac output when increased is given below:

contractility - an increase in contractility of the heart increases the cardiac outputPreload - an increase in preload increases cardiac outputafterload - an increase in afterload decreases cardiac output

Therefore, the three main factors that affect stroke volume are contractility, preload and afterload.

Four different thermometers were used to measure the temperature of a sample of impure boiling water. The measurements are recorded in the table below.

Thermometer Temperature
Reading 1 Temperature
Reading 2 Temperature
Reading 3
W 100.1°C 99.9°C 96.9°C
X 100.4°C 102.3°C 101.4°C
Y 90.0°C 95.2°C 98.6°C
Z 90.8°C 90.6°C 90.7°C

The actual boiling point of pure water is 100.0°C.

What can be concluded from the data about the reliability and validity of the thermometers?

A.
Thermometer W is the most reliable.
B.
Thermometer X has the highest validity.
C.
Thermometer Z is the most reliable.
D.
Thermometer Y has the highest validity.

Answers

Thermometer Z is the most reliable but has the least validity.Thermometer W has the highest validity.The rank for reliability, from most reliable to least reliable, is:              Z > X > W > YThe rank for validity, from greatest validy to lowest validity is:              W > X > Y > Z

How, explain your answer?

Reliability is another name for the precision of the measurement, and it means how well the value is repeated; this is, how close the different measurements are to each other. If the measurements are close one to each other, then the instrument is precise or reliable (high reliability).

Validity is another name for the accuracy of the measurement; this is, how close the measurement is to the true or accepted value.

With that, we can compare the reliability (precision) and validity (accuracy) of the four different thermometers.

Repeat the table:

Temperatures in °C:

Thermometer  Reading 1   Reading 2   Reading 3

       W                 100.1             99.9             96.9

        X                 100.4           102.3             101.4

        Y                  90.0            95.2             98.6

        Z                  90.8             90.6            90.7

Reliability:

To analyze reliability (precision) we must compare the measures of every thermometer among them. A good approximation can be made calculating the range, i.e. the difference between the largest and the smallest readings:

For W: largest reading - smallest reading = 100.1°C - 96.9°C = 3.2°CFor X: largest reading - smallest reading = 102.3°C - 100.4°C = 1.9°CFor Y: largest reading - smallest reading = 98.6°C - 90.0°C = 8.6°CFor Z: largest reading - smallest reading = 90.8°C - 90.6°C = 0.2°C

Now, you conclude that the most reliable is thermometer Z and the least reliable is thermometer Y. The complete ranking, from most reliable to least reliable is:

Z > X > W > Y

Validity:

To determine validity you must compare the mean of the three measures for each thermometer with the accepted value for the boiling point of pure water (100.0°C).

The mean is the sum of the three readings divided by 3.

The absolute error is calculated with the formula:

absolute error = | accepted value - calculated value |.

The calculated value is the mean.

For W: mean = (100.1 + 99.9 + 96.9)°C / 3 = 99.0°C

                   absolute error = 100.0°C - 99.0°C = 1.0°C

For X: mean = (100.4 + 102.3 + 101.4)°C / 3 = 101.4 °C

                  absolute error = 101.4°C - 100.0°C = 1.4° For Y: mean = (90.0 + 95.2 + 98.6)°C / 3 = 94.6°C

                  absolute error = 100.0°C - 94.6°C = 5.4°C

For Z: mean = (90.8 + 90.6 + 90.7)°C / 3 = 90.7°C

                  absolute error = 100.0°C - 90.7°C = 9.3°C

Now you can rank the thermometers as per their validity (accuracy):

1.0°C < 1.4°C < 5.4°C < 9.3°C

Thus, W is the most accurate, X is the second most accurate, Y is the third, and Z is the least accurate.

What is malaria?

A parasite that frequently infects a particular species of mosquito that feeds on people can result in the serious and occasionally fatal disease known as malaria. Malaria often causes severe disease, including high fevers, shivering chills, and flu-like symptoms. Humans can contract four different types of malaria parasites: Falciparum Plasmodium, P.

Female Anopheles mosquitoes carrying the Plasmodium parasite bite people to feed their own eggs, which is how the parasite is propagated. An infected mosquito injects sporozoites, or early stages of the parasite, into the host's bloodstream while it consumes its prey (often between twilight and sunrise). The sporozoites are transported by the blood to the liver, where they develop into schizonts, which are a type of parasite. Each schizont multiplies into thousands of merozoites throughout the course of the following one to two weeks. The merozoites escape the liver and re-enter the bloodstream where they assault red blood cells, continue to grow and divide, and eventually kill the blood cells.
